For anyone having issues with "Force close" errors in a lot of apps in Nitrdoid (OOME usually), the following fix should help:
1. Boot into Maemo
2. Open X-Term (Ctrl+X)
3. Run 'vi /home/system/build.prop'
4. Press i to change to edit/insert mode
5. At the end of the file, add the following line:
dalvik.vm.heapsize=32m
6. Press 'esc', write ':wq'
7. Boot back into Nitdroid and you should be sweet
